Compensation:
This is an hourly, non-exempt position. Base rate of pay will be $20.17-22.11/hr. (Roughly $42,000-46,000 annually) with occasional pre-approved overtime possible. This position may be eligible for performance-based incentives that will be paid at company discretion.
Work Location and Schedule:
This position is based in our Pittsburgh (Greentree), PA office. Our office has free parking and is accessible via public transportation. This is a fully in-person role requiring the ability to work from the office Monday-Friday. Position is typically scheduled for 9:30AM-6:30PM.
As our Fulfillment Specialist, you will:
â Prepare smartphones, tablets, and accessories for shipment, including installing screen protectors, cases, recording device ID numbers.
â Package and label orders accurately.
â Track inventory and maintain organized records.
â Help ensure customers receive the correct devices and equipment.
â Work with team members to solve customer issues.
â Learn industry-leading mobile technology and device management systems.
â Work in our Pittsburgh, PA warehouse five days a week. The nature of this role requires on-site work.
